Skincare fans of all ages are praising this ‘miracle in a jar’ face cream that claims to reduce the appearance of dark spots, pigmentation, and ageing.

Users of the NIVEA Cellular Luminous 630 Anti Dark Spot Night Cream, £13.49 here (was £26.99) have been astonished by the results after using it, with shops up to 70 years old leaving a glowing review of the face cream.

Promising results in just four weeks, the NIVEA night cream was created to help counteract the visible signs of ageing, as well as reduce the appearance of dark spots and pigmentation in the skin.The formula contains cell-activating hyaluronic acid which is well known for its ability to regenerate and strengthen the skin, as well as helping it to retain moisture, leaving it softer and more hydrated.
